Reducing waste disposal costs
A
significant part of the wood processed through a sawmill does not end
up as a timber product. In some cases, up to a half of the processed
wood is not utilised as timber. This material is sawn, shaved or cut
off and therefore is comprised of many different forms. A large
propotion of this is usually sold on for other purposes. Avoiding the
high costs of disposing of the remaining waste to landfills is a
principal economic driver for new bioenergy plant.
